Materials and techniques | Fritware with underglaze painting in blue and yellow slip |
Brief description | Bowl, fritware, underglaze painted in blue with floating islands, palmettes and interlaced arabesques in yellowish-green slipunder a clear glaze; Iran, 1650-70. |
